MMA Convert — ... And getting paid he did. Dana awarded him $140,000 in bonus money for his performance against Anthony Johnson. Koscheck said he wanted to weather the early storm and use his wrestling to take Johnson down and submit him, which was exactly what happened. Meanwhile, Johnson said the eye pokes took him out of game giving Koscheck the opening to take over the fight. ...

MMA Interplay — ... Center in Las Vegas. The contest was full of bizarre stoppages and mishaps between eye pokes from both sides and a controversial knee while “Kos” was grounded. “Rumble” contends the knee never made head contact and that his loss can be attributed to the aforementioned eye mashing.
